The FSA ID is a combination of a username and password that you use to access online systems provided by the U.S. Department of Education (ED). Your FSA ID serves as your legal signature and should only be created and used by you. It is important that no one else, including your parents, children, school officials, or representatives from loan companies, use your FSA ID.

For parents and students, having an FSA ID before starting the FAFSA is the fastest way to sign and process your application. It’s also the only way to access or correct your information online or to prefill an online FAFSA form with information from your previous year’s FAFSA form.
